The lock/unlock feature provides the ability to disallow data entry against G/L accounts. Once an account has been locked, all data entry to that account is prohibited. However, invoice entry distributions will be allowed on locked accounts when the invoice is entered against a purchase order, as the commitment distribution was made when the account was not locked.
Use the following steps to lock/unlock a G/L:
1. Click on the Business tab, click General Ledger, and select G/L Account Management.
Note: The Session Accounting Year field will display the current year the user is signed in to.
2. If known, enter the Account Number.
3. Click on the Search button. The G/L account will be retrieved in the grid.
Note: If necessary, perform an advanced search. Refer to Advanced Search for more information on this section.
4. Click on the Action drop-down menu beside the corresponding G/L account and select Lock or Unlock.

5. Enter a note in the Note field.
6. Click on the OK button to complete the process or click on the Cancel button to cancel the Lock or Unlock process.
